Healthy Oatmeal Pancakes

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 10 minutes
Total Time: 20 minutes
Servings: 12 pancakes

Ingredients

  • 2 cups quick oats, (see Note for substitution)
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 2 1/2 cups buttermilk, (see Note for substitution)
  • 1 cup flour
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on sugar
  • 1/3 cup vegetable or canola oil
  • 2 eggs, beaten

Instructions
 

  • Combine oats, baking soda, and buttermilk. Let mixture stand for 5 minutes.
  • In another bowl combine flour, baking powder, salt, and sugar.
  • Add the oil and eggs to the oat mixture and stir to combine.
  • Add the dry ingredients to the oat mixture and stir until blended.
  • Cook on lightly greased griddle or skillet.
  • Top with syrup, yogurt, fruit, applesauce, peanut butter, or jam.

Notes

Quick Oats Substitute: If you only have old-fashioned oats pulse them in the blender briefly to chop them up slightly and then you have quick oats!
Buttermilk Substitute: Substitute buttermilk with 2 1/4 cups milk and 2 tablespoons white vinegar or lemon juice. Let mixture sit for 5 minutes or until it appears to curdle.
